About Biotage
Biotage is a global supplier and solutions partner to a wide range of customers within drug discovery and development and analytical testing. With strong expertise in separation and purification technologies, and a focus on leveraging intelligent workflow solutions, we aim to efficiently support the advancement and protection of human health.
